Kyle Jamieson is a right-arm fast-medium bowler whose unique bowling style is renowned in the world of modern cricket. Towering at 6’8”, the New Zealand pacer burst onto the international stage and plays consistently well across the formats. Jamieson made his international debut in 2020 and earned the Player of the Tournament award in the 2021 ICC World Test Championship, where New Zealand lifted the title.

Kyle Jamieson Biography
The Kiwi cricketer was born on December 30, 1994, in Auckland, New Zealand. Kyle Jamieson height is 6 feet 8 inches, and he is one of the tallest cricketers in the world. He is known for his bounce and control on the field. Jamieson grew up playing cricket in Auckland and later moved to Canterbury, where his career developed strongly at the domestic level.
He progressed through New Zealand’s domestic cricket and refined his skills as a right-arm fast-medium bowler. His consistent performances earned him a place in the national cricket team of New Zealand, marking the start of a successful international career.

Kyle Jamieson Career
-1768567259563.webp)
The 31-year-old cricketer, Kyle Jamieson career started as a towering fast-bowler from New Zealand, renowned for his bounce and ability to swing the ball. He made his ODI debut on February 08, 2020, playing against India. Jamieson played his first Test match on February 21, 2020, against India, and then made his T20I debut on November 27, 2020, playing against West Indies.
International Career
Kyle Jamieson is one of the best bowlers in the world, who has played 64 international matches in her career, where he has taken a total of 130 wickets with an impressive average. In his international career, he has also taken five 4-wicket hauls, five 5-wicket hauls, and one 10-wicket haul.
| Format | Mat | Inns | Balls | Runs | Wkts | BBI | BBM | Ave | Econ | SR | 4w | 5w | 10w |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Tests | 19 | 36 | 3558 | 1579 | 80 | 6/48 | 11/117 | 19.73 | 2.66 | 44.4 | 4 | 5 | 1 |
| ODIs | 22 | 21 | 1054 | 922 | 29 | 4/41 | 4/41 | 31.79 | 5.24 | 36.3 | 1 | 0 | 0 |
| T20Is | 23 | 23 | 481 | 738 | 21 | 3/8 | 3/8 | 35.14 | 9.20 | 22.9 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Other Leagues Career
Kyle Jamieson has played in some of the biggest cricket leagues in the world, such as IPL, PSL, and Vitality Blast. He has played 13 matches in the IPL, playing for RCB and PBKS, where he has taken 14 wickets. Jamieson has played 2 matches in the PSL for Quetta Gladiators and has also played 5 matches in the Vitality Blast, playing for Surrey.
| Tournament | Teams | Mat | Inns | Balls | Runs | Wkts | BBI | BBM | Ave | Econ | SR | 4w |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| PSL | QG | 2 | 2 | 42 | 63 | 2 | 1/28 | 1/28 | 31.50 | 9.00 | 21.0 | 0 |
| IPL | RCB, PBKS | 13 | 13 | 258 | 416 | 14 | 3/41 | 3/41 | 29.71 | 9.67 | 18.4 | 0 |
| Vitality Blast | SUR | 5 | 5 | 83 | 132 | 1 | 1/27 | 1/27 | 132.00 | 9.54 | 83.0 | 0 |
Kyle Jamieson Achievements & Awards
The Kiwi cricketer, Kyle Jamieson, won the ICC Men’s Emerging Player of the Year in 2020 for his amazing debut performance. In 2021, he won the Player of the Match in the ICC World Test Championship finals, defeating India. Jamieson took a five-wicket haul on his Test debut and, in 2021, he won the ICC Test Team of the Year award.
| Year | Award / Achievement | Category | Result |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2020 | ICC Men’s Emerging Player of the Year | Individual Award | Won for his outstanding debut year in international cricket across formats |
| 2021 | ICC World Test Championship Winner | Team Achievement | Part of the New Zealand team that defeated India in the inaugural WTC final |
| 2021 | Player of the Match – WTC Final | Individual Performance | Recognized for match-winning bowling performance in the WTC final |
| 2020 | Test Debut Five-Wicket Haul | Career Milestone | Claimed 5/31 on debut vs India, marking one of the best debut performances |
| 2021 | ICC Test Team of the Year | Team Selection | Selected among the world’s best Test cricketers for consistent performances |
